"深入了解Arduino:从单片机到控制应用"。

版权申诉
0 下载量 109 浏览量 更新于2024-04-18 收藏 893KB PDF 举报
Arduino 是一种基于 AVR 指令集的单片机平台,为开发者提供了一个简单而强大的工具来创造交互式的项目。单片机是一种集成了中央处理单元(CPU)、随机存储器(RAM)、存储器(ROM)和输入/输出设备(I/O)等部件的微控制器,与个人计算机相比,单片机集成度更高,运行速度更快。在实际应用中,单片机被广泛用于控制系统、自动化设备、电子产品和各种嵌入式系统中。 Arduino 的学习可以帮助我们了解如何使用单片机来设计和开发各种项目。通过 Arduino,我们可以实现各种功能,如传感器数据采集、控制执行机构、通信等。Arduino 提供了一个易于上手的开发平台,具有丰富的库函数和开发工具,开发者可以快速上手并实现各种创意项目。 在学习 Arduino 过程中,我们首先需要了解单片机的基本原理,包括中央处理单元的功能、存储器的作用以及输入/输出设备的连接方式。了解这些基础知识可以帮助我们更好地理解 Arduino 的工作原理和使用方法。同时,我们还需要学习如何使用 Arduino IDE(集成开发环境)来编写程序、上传程序和调试程序,这是 Arduino 开发的基础。 除了基础知识外,我们还需要学习如何连接各种传感器和执行机构到 Arduino 板上,以及如何编写程序来获取传感器数据并控制执行机构。在 Arduino 学习笔记中,我们可以学习到如何使用 Arduino 控制LED灯、蜂鸣器、舵机等执行器,并实现各种功能,如温湿度监测、遥控小车等。 总的来说,通过学习 Arduino,我们可以了解单片机的工作原理、掌握编程技能,实现各种创意项目,提升自己的技术水平。Arduino 提供了一个开放、灵活、易用的开发平台,为创客们提供了一个实现梦想的机会,让创意得以实现。在未来的学习和工作中,我们可以继续深入学习 Arduino,并将其运用到更多的项目和领域中,创造更多的价值和实现更多的梦想。Arduino,让创造无限可能!